Bug 169357

Summary: font variation properties don't need to accept numbers
Product: WebKit Reporter: Myles C. Maxfield <mmaxfield>
Component: TextAssignee: Myles C. Maxfield <mmaxfield>
Status: RESOLVED FIXED    
Severity: Normal CC: buildbot, commit-queue, dino, hyatt, jonlee, koivisto, mmaxfield, rniwa, simon.fraser, thorton
Priority: P2    
Version: Other   
Hardware: Unspecified   
OS: Unspecified   
Bug Depends on:    
Bug Blocks: 162815    
Attachments:
Description Flags
Patch
none
Archive of layout-test-results from ews100 for mac-elcapitan
none
Archive of layout-test-results from ews116 for mac-elcapitan
none
Archive of layout-test-results from ews107 for mac-elcapitan-wk2
none
Patch none

Description Myles C. Maxfield 2017-03-08 09:13:13 PST
https://github.com/w3c/csswg-drafts/issues/524

We should also test calc() with percentages.
Comment 1 Myles C. Maxfield 2017-03-24 19:29:55 PDT
Created attachment 305353 [details]
Patch
Comment 2 Myles C. Maxfield 2017-03-24 19:32:54 PDT
*** Bug 169321 has been marked as a duplicate of this bug. ***
Comment 3 Build Bot 2017-03-24 20:10:08 PDT
Comment on attachment 305353 [details]
Patch

Attachment 305353 [details] did not pass mac-ews (mac):
Output: http://webkit-queues.webkit.org/results/3407111

New failing tests:
fast/text/font-selection-font-face-parse.html
Comment 4 Build Bot 2017-03-24 20:10:11 PDT
Created attachment 305356 [details]
Archive of layout-test-results from ews100 for mac-elcapitan

The attached test failures were seen while running run-webkit-tests on the mac-ews.
Bot: ews100  Port: mac-elcapitan  Platform: Mac OS X 10.11.6
Comment 5 Build Bot 2017-03-24 20:23:48 PDT
Comment on attachment 305353 [details]
Patch

Attachment 305353 [details] did not pass mac-debug-ews (mac):
Output: http://webkit-queues.webkit.org/results/3407132

New failing tests:
fast/text/font-selection-font-face-parse.html
Comment 6 Build Bot 2017-03-24 20:23:50 PDT
Created attachment 305357 [details]
Archive of layout-test-results from ews116 for mac-elcapitan

The attached test failures were seen while running run-webkit-tests on the mac-debug-ews.
Bot: ews116  Port: mac-elcapitan  Platform: Mac OS X 10.11.6
Comment 7 Build Bot 2017-03-24 20:39:16 PDT
Comment on attachment 305353 [details]
Patch

Attachment 305353 [details] did not pass mac-wk2-ews (mac-wk2):
Output: http://webkit-queues.webkit.org/results/3407184

New failing tests:
fast/text/font-selection-font-face-parse.html
Comment 8 Build Bot 2017-03-24 20:39:19 PDT
Created attachment 305358 [details]
Archive of layout-test-results from ews107 for mac-elcapitan-wk2

The attached test failures were seen while running run-webkit-tests on the mac-wk2-ews.
Bot: ews107  Port: mac-elcapitan-wk2  Platform: Mac OS X 10.11.6
Comment 9 Myles C. Maxfield 2017-03-24 21:20:12 PDT
Created attachment 305363 [details]
Patch
Comment 10 Antti Koivisto 2017-03-27 10:12:54 PDT
r=me
Comment 11 WebKit Commit Bot 2017-03-27 10:50:37 PDT
Comment on attachment 305363 [details]
Patch

Clearing flags on attachment: 305363

Committed r214419: <http://trac.webkit.org/changeset/214419>
Comment 12 WebKit Commit Bot 2017-03-27 10:50:42 PDT
All reviewed patches have been landed.  Closing bug.